// derpAddrFamSelector is the derphttp.AddressFamilySelector we pass
// to derphttp.Client.SetAddressFamilySelector.
//
// It provides the hint as to whether in an IPv4-vs-IPv6 race that
// IPv4 should be held back a bit to give IPv6 a better-than-50/50
// chance of winning. We only return true when we believe IPv6 will
// work anyway, so we don't artificially delay the connection speed.
type derpAddrFamSelector struct{ c *Conn }
func (s derpAddrFamSelector) PreferIPv6() bool {
if r, ok := s.c.lastNetCheckReport.Load().(*netcheck.Report); ok {
return r.IPv6
}
return false
}
